The Evolution of Content in Digital Casinos
Traditional slot machines and digital equivalents have transitioned from simple random-number generators to sophisticated platforms integrating storytelling, social features, and high-end graphics. Industry analysts report that in 2023, over 70% of newly launched slot titles emphasize thematic storytelling and innovative mechanics, reflecting a strategic shift toward differentiated content.
One significant driver behind this evolution is the competition among game developers to stand out in a crowded marketplace. Leading providers invest heavily in game design, narrative depth, and unique features to attract both casual players and high rollers. The end goal is fostering “sticky” gaming experiences that extend playtime and increase lifetime value.
The Role of Innovation in Player Retention
In the context of a saturated market, innovation becomes a key differentiator. For example, hybrid games that combine elements of traditional slots with skill-based mechanics or narrative-driven features are gaining popularity. These innovations appeal particularly to younger demographics seeking more interaction and agency within their gaming experience.
| Feature | Impact | Examples |
|---|---|---|
| Gamification | Increases engagement and retention through rewards and progression systems | Leaderboards, achievement badges |
| Augmented Reality (AR) & Virtual Reality (VR) | Creates immersive environments that mimic land-based casinos | VR blackjack, AR slots |
| Interactive Storytelling | Deepens player connection through thematic narratives | Elaborate fictional worlds, character-driven plots |
The Rise of Themed Slot Games and Niche Markets
One prominent trend is the proliferation of themed slots that tap into popular culture, history, or unique narratives. These games harness narrative depth to foster emotional investment, often resulting in higher play frequency and longer session times. Niche markets, such as Western, mythology, or adventure themes, are particularly fertile grounds for innovation, appealing to dedicated demographics seeking specialised content.
